EndNote Basics Workshop In-Person
In this one-hour workshop, you will learn the basics of using EndNote, a citation management software used to manage citations in personal libraries and create bibliographies based on a number of available journal or writing styles, including:
- Acquiring EndNote through the OHSU Library
- Managing citations by creating an EndNote library
- Downloading and importing citations though a variety of databases such as PubMed
- Creating bibliographies in a number of journal and writing styles
